Zingmet Tablet is a prescription medication used to manage and control high blood sugar levels in adults with type 2 diabetes. It is typically prescribed when a single or double treatment medicine is no longer sufficient to keep blood sugar within a target range. By keeping blood sugar levels controlled, this medication helps prevent serious, long-term complications associated with diabetes.
For the best results, you must take Zingmet Tablet regularly and consistently exactly as prescribed by your doctor. It is highly recommended to take this tablet with food, specifically with your first main meal of the day, to reduce the chances of a stomach upset. Alongside taking this medication, adopting healthy lifestyle habits such as eating a balanced, low-sugar diet and engaging in regular physical activity is essential to achieve optimal blood sugar control.
While taking Zingmet Tablet , some people may experience mild side effects like nausea, a metallic taste in the mouth, or low blood sugar. However, if you experience sudden swelling in your legs, shortness of breath, severe stomach pain, or yellowing of your skin or eyes, you must stop taking the medication and consult your doctor immediately.
Do not take this if you have severe kidney disease, active liver damage, or severe heart failure. Before starting Zingmet Tablet , it is crucial to tell your doctor if you have a history of bladder cancer, fluid retention, or heart conditions.
This medicine can interact with alcohol, which significantly increases your risk of dangerously low blood sugar and a rare but serious condition called lactic acidosis. If you are pregnant, planning to become pregnant, breastfeeding, or are an elderly individual, you must talk to your doctor or pharmacist before using this medicine, as alternative treatments may be safer.

Unsafe
You are recommended to avoid consumption of alcohol with Zingmet Tablet as it may increase the risk of lactic acidosis (accumulation of lactic acid in the body).
Unsafe
Zingmet Tablet is not recommended for pregnant women as it may harm an unborn baby. Please consult a doctor if you are pregnant or planning for pregnancy.
Unsafe
Avoid breastfeeding while taking Zingmet Tablet as it may be excreted in breastmilk and cause adverse effects in the baby. Therefore, please consult a doctor before using Zingmet Tablet if you are breastfeeding.
Caution
Zingmet Tablet may decrease alertness in some people. Therefore, drive only if you are alert after taking Zingmet Tablet .
Caution
Take Zingmet Tablet with caution, especially if you have a history of Liver diseases/conditions. The dose may be adjusted by your doctor as required.
Caution
Take Zingmet Tablet with caution, especially if you have a history of Kidney diseases/conditions. The dose may be adjusted by your doctor as required.
Unsafe
Zingmet Tablet is not recommended for children as the safety and effectiveness were not established.
Caution
Zingmet Tablet should be used with caution in patients with heart problems. Inform your doctor about any heart-related conditions before taking Zingmet Tablet .
Caution
Zingmet Tablet should be given with caution in elderly patients due to an increased risk of side effects. Seek medical advice before using Zingmet Tablet .
